Output 24973fc72ef1368c1874e496b615dff01b0c1768c7f08e3cd592e32a01afe55c:0

value
624860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35068d28d98ff4cd45f89c466a174fa230ab276c OP_EQUAL
address
36XPaukd5Vy7KhzmNF3marNG6djpSoCieF
transaction
24973fc72ef1368c1874e496b615dff01b0c1768c7f08e3cd592e32a01afe55c
spent
true